Profile: Rand Engineering & Arch is a Engineering, architectural, and surveying services company located at New York, New York USA, address is 159 W 25th St # 12, New York 10001-7218 NY, postcode is 10001-7218, you can contact Rand Engineering & Arch by phone 2126917972
Please share as much information as you can about Rand Engineering & Arch so other users can benefit from your comment.